SBIR-STTR Award

Transformational Mapping of Formal Specifications onto Parallel Architectures
Award last edited on: 11/20/02

Sponsored Program
SBIR
Awarding Agency
DOD : AF
Total Award Amount
$99,888
Award Phase
1
Solicitation Topic Code
AF96-038
Principal Investigator
Stephen J Westfold

Company Information

Suresoft Inc

3260 Hillview Avenue 2nd Floor
Palo Alto, CA 94304
   (415) 493-6871
   N/A
   N/A
Location: Single
Congr. District: 18
County: Santa Clara

Phase I

Contract Number: F30602-96-C-0148
Start Date: 4/18/96    Completed: 10/18/96
Phase I year
1996
Phase I Amount
$99,888
Suresoft Inc., is a commercial spinoff from Kestrel Institute, with the charter to commercialize Kestrel's advanced technology. Suresoft will design and build an advanced parallel software development environment, Parallelware, for systematically mapping high-level specifications onto diverse parallel architectures. The tool will be graphically based, providing visual interaction at the requirements, specification, design, implementation, and performance analysis stages. The tool may be used to produce highly efficient parallel software for parallel architectures while ensuring correctness. Parallelware will provide high-level design tactics for parallel algorithms, architecture-independent refinement and architecture-oriented translations. Parallelware will incorporate a development process model that will guide the user from abstract level to various detailed levels with embedded domain knowledge and design theories. The basis of the Parallelware is the generic software development environment SPECWARE (a realization of KBSA methodology), where a firm theoretical foundation exists. SPECWARE has an open architecture that supports its evolution to specialized development tasks, such as parallel software development; and integration with other tools. Parallelware will be basically a domain-specific extension of the more general SPECWARE system. Key individuals from Kestrel that helped develop SPECWARE and KIDS will assist in the technology transfer effort.

Keywords:
PARALLEL SOFTWARE REFINEMENT FORMAL SPECIFICATIONS TRANSFORMATION TECHNOLOGY ARCHITECTURE

Phase II

Contract Number: ----------
Start Date: 00/00/00    Completed: 00/00/00
Phase II year
----
Phase II Amount
----